How Can Peptides Stimulate Collagen Creation?

The generation of collagen is necessary for upholding skin integrity and tautness, and molecular compounds contribute significantly to encouraging this process. These short chains of constituent elements serve as signaling molecules, engaging with skin cells to amplify collagen generation. When applied topically or ingested, peptides can traverse the skin barrier, stimulating collagen-producing structures—cells responsible for producing collagen—to maximize their output.

Research indicates that certain peptides, such as palmitoyl pentapeptide, can enhance the skin's flexibility and diminish the appearance of wrinkles by promoting collagen formation. Additionally, peptides can help to control the breakdown of collagen, ensuring a balanced turnover. This two-fold effect of boosting new collagen production while protecting existing collagen results in a more youthful-looking and firm skin appearance. Ultimately, incorporating peptides into daily skincare regimens can appreciably support skin health and vitality by increasing collagen levels.

Peptides and Their Function in Complexion repair

By harnessing their unique properties, peptides play an key role in skin repair and regeneration. These short chains of amino acids act as messenger agents, prompting cellular processes required for skin repair. Peptides, when applied topically, help stimulate the production of collagen and elastin, critical proteins that maintain skin structure and elasticity. This stimulation can lead to enhanced skin texture and lessened app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.

Likewise, peptides demonstrate anti-inflammatory properties, which can settle irritated skin and advance the recuperation of wounds and blemishes. Their capacity to enhance the skin barrier function is also noteworthy, as it allows sustain hydration and shield against outside elements. By activating cellular turnover, peptides activate the production of fresh, vibrant skin cells, contributing to a more radiant and youthful look. To sum up, the use of peptides into skincare routines can considerably enhance skin health and resilience.

Deciding On The Perfect Products

As individuals seek to enhance their skincare routines, choosing the right peptide products becomes vital for achieving optimal results. It is crucial to identify particular skin concerns, such as wrinkles, dry skin, or textural irregularities, as various peptides address different issues. Shoppers should look for products that feature peptides high on the ingredient panel, indicating a higher concentration. Additionally, considering the formula is significant; serums and creams often provide better penetration than alternative product formats. Reading reviews and checking for scientific research can offer information into a product's efficacy. Finally, selecting trusted brands that emphasize quality and transparency in their sourcing of ingredients will guarantee a reliable addition to any skin care routine.

Common Inquired Questions

What Side Effects Can Result From Using Peptides on the Skin?

Indeed, administering peptides onto the skin might produce side effects such as irritation, allergic reactions, or sensitivity in certain individuals. It is essential to undertake a localized test before total application to curtail risks.

Can Peptides Be Consumed Orally for Wellness advantages?

Yes, peptides can be taken by mouth for health benefits. Research indicates that certain peptides may enhance muscle recovery, support immune function, and enhance general health, although personal outcomes may differ and further studies are needed.

How Much Time Is necessary to see Changes From Peptides?

Outcomes from peptides are usually noticeable within four to twelve weeks, based on individual factors like the specific peptide used, dosage, and the particular health or skin condition treated.

Can amino acid chains be effective for every skin types?

Peptides prove effective for multiple skin types, such as oily, dry, and sensitive skin. However, personal responses may change, so it's important for users to conduct patch tests and seek guidance from dermatologists for personalized advice.

Can Peptides Suitable Alongside Various Skincare Ingredients?

Yes, peptides can be combined with other skin care components. They often work synergistically with actives like hyaluronic acid and oxidative stress fighters, elevating overall results. However, consumers should check their skin's reaction to assure compatibility with specific ingredient mixes.
